WEBOct 22, 2019 · Instructions. Pour 1/2 cup of water into the bowl of a stand mixer (remove the beaters for now) and sprinkle the gelatin on top. …

1. Pour 1/2 cup of water into the bowl of a stand mixer (remove the beaters for now) and sprinkle the gelatin on top. Allow the gelatin to bloom for at least 10 minutes.
2. While the gelatin is blooming, add the remaining 1/2 cup water, honey and salt to a small pot with a candy thermometer. Heat on medium-high and stir the mixture for the first minute only, keeping a close eye that it doesn't boil over (*stirring later in the process may contribute to the sugar mixture boiling over). Cook until the mixture reaches 240 degrees fahrenheit (the "soft ball" stage). This should take approximately 12-15 minutes.
3. Turn the stand mixer on low to break up the gelatin and slowly and carefully pour the sugar mixture on top. Gradually increase the speed to high and beat until the mixture has tripled in size, resembles marshmallow fluff and is cool to the touch. This should take approximately 8-10 minutes. In the last minute, add the vanilla bean or vanilla extract.
4. While the marshmallow is beating, line a 9x9 pan with parchment paper. Stir the powdered sugar and arrowroot powder together in a separate bowl and sprinkle onto the parchment paper.
